Summary · Congress.gov
This concurrent resolution expresses support for law enforcement officers. It also appreciates the contributions and recognizes the sacrifices of law enforcement officers.

Action Timeline

2026-05-14
Received in the Senate.
2026-05-13
Motion to reconsider laid on the table Agreed to without objection.
2026-05-13
On agreeing to the resolution Agreed to by the Yeas and Nays: 243 - 173, 3 Present (Roll no. 165). (text: CR H3428)
2026-05-13
Passed/agreed to in House: On agreeing to the resolution Agreed to by the Yeas and Nays: 243 - 173, 3 Present (Roll no. 165). (text: CR H3428)
2026-05-13
Considered as unfinished business. (consideration: CR H3436)
2026-05-13
POSTPONED PROCEEDINGS - At the conclusion of debate on H.Con.Res 96, the Chair put the question on agreeing to the resolution and by voice vote, announced the ayes had prevailed. Mr. Raskin demanded the yeas and nays and the Chair postponed
2026-05-13
The previous question was ordered pursuant to the rule.
2026-05-13
DEBATE - The House proceeded with one hour of debate on H. Con. Res. 96.
2026-05-13
Rule provides for consideration of H.R. 5625, H.R. 6260, H.R. 8365, H. Con. Res. 96 and H.R. 8469. The resolution provides for consideration of H.R. 5625, H.R. 6260, H.R. 8365, and H.Con.Res. 96 under a closed rule. The resolution provides
2026-05-13
Considered under the provisions of rule H. Res. 1275. (consideration: CR H3428-3434)
